首页 > 软件 > .使用rand函数生成50个随机数,统计大于0.5的元素个数所占的百分比

.使用rand函数生成50个随机数,统计大于0.5的元素个数所占的百分比

软件 2023-07-04

matlab急需答案

1 利用Matlab提供的rand函数生成1000个符合均匀分布的随机数,然后检验随机数的性质: (1)求均值和标准方差; (2)最大元素和最小元素; (3)大于0.5随机数个数占总数的百分比。 A=rand(1,1000); MEAN=mean(A);%均值 STD=std(A);%标准方差 MAX=max(A);%最大元素 MIN=min(A);%最小元素 t=length(find(A>0.5));%大于0.5随机数个数 D=t/1000;%大于0.5随机数个数占总数的百分比。

怎么用RAND函数产生50-100的随机数。

方法:可以在Excel中利用Rand函数生成50-100的随机数,方法如下:

1、新建一个Excel文件并点击打开,如下图所示;

2、进入excel工作区后,在任意单元格中输入=RAND()*(最大值-最小值)+最小值,如输入=RAND()*(100-50)+50,如下图所示;

3、输入完成后点击回车就可以得到第一个随机数字,如下图所示;

4、选择该单元格,将鼠标置于该单元格右下角,然后往下拉动就可以得到很多在50—100的随机数字了,如下图所示。

用生成随机数命令rand()生成一些随机数如果生成的数大于等于0.5输出数1否则输出数0

#include #include int function(int x) { if (x < -1) { return 1; } else if (x>=-1 && x <= 1) { return 0; } else { //没有定义次区间 printf("ERROR!!!"); return -1; } } int main() { if (rand() >= 0.5) { printf("1\n"); } else { printf("0\n"); } int y; y = function(-2); y = function(0); y =

在excel表中取50个随机数字,将其分组,并给出平均数,标准差与变异系数

给你几个会涉及到的公式: 50个随机数字:=rand()*倍数。你随便在一个单元格输入,然后拖拉填充柄50个数。rand()公式是随机取0~1之间的小数,你可以乘以10,就是0~10之间的数。 平均数:=average(50个随机数) 标准差:=stdev(50个随机数) 变异系数:=average(50个随机数)/stdev(50个随机数)*100%

使用随机函数rand()产生50个10~99的互不相同的随机整数放入数组a中,再按从大到小的顺序排序,并以每行

把第7行到第15行换成以下代码:

char*p;
p=newchar[90];
for(i=0;i<90;i++)
p[i]=0;
for(i=0;i<50;i++){
t=rand()%(90-i);
b=0;
for(k=0;k<90;k++){
if(b==t)break;
if(p[k]==0)b++;
}
p[k]=1;
a[i]=k+10;
}
delete[]p;

标签:信息技术 随机数 编程语言 函数 编程

大明白知识网 Copyright © 2020-2022 www.wangpan131.com. Some Rights Reserved. 京ICP备11019930号-18